Historic La Quinta Cove: A Vibrant Desert Destination

Nestled at the foot of the Santa Rosa Mountains, Historic La Quinta Cove is a charming and lively community that perfectly blends natural beauty, local culture, and modern amenities. Whether you’re a visitor or a resident, the Cove offers an authentic desert experience with something for everyone.

Downtown La Quinta: Markets, Art, and Culture
Just a short stroll from the Cove, Downtown La Quinta is a bustling hub of activity. Every Sunday, the Downtown La Quinta Farmers Market comes alive with fresh produce, artisan goods, and local treats. Stroll through the stalls, sample gourmet foods,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ere.

The Cove also hosts regular Art Fairs, showcasing the talents of local and regional artists. These fairs are a must-see for art lovers and collectors, offering unique pieces and a chance to meet the artists in person.

Dining and Entertainment
La Quinta Cove is home to a variety of acclaimed restaurants and entertainment venues. Enjoy a memorable meal at Arnold Palmer’s, where classic American cuisine is served in a golf legend’s namesake setting, or experience fine dining at Lavender Bistro, known for its romantic ambiance and innovative dishes.

For a more casual evening, explore local wine bars and lively entertainment. From live music to cozy lounges, there’s always something happening after dark.

Shopping, Rentals, and Outdoor Fun
Downtown La Quinta features an array of boutique shops, offering everything from unique fashion to home décor and gifts. For those looking to explore, golf cart and bike rentals are available, making it easy to cruise around town or venture into the scenic trails surrounding the Cove.

World-Class Events and Nearby Attractions
La Quinta is at the center of some of the desert’s most celebrated events. The Stagecoach and Coachella music festivals are just a short drive away, drawing music lovers from around the world. Equestrian enthusiasts will appreciate the proximity to the Thermal Horse Park and rodeo events, which provide thrilling competitions and family fun.

Sports fans can catch world-class tennis at the Indian Wells Tennis Garden, home to the BNP Paribas Open, or enjoy concerts and gaming at nearby casino venues.
